>Description:
When booting up in single user mode, the USB keyboard does not respond.
The keyboard responds at the beastie loader, and also at the multi
user login prompt.
Note: i have usb keyboard legacy support enabled in the bios.
>How-To-Repeat:
1. at the beastie loader, select "single user mode".
2. you will then reach a prompt:
Enter full pathname of shell or RETURN for /bin/sh:
at this point, the USB keyboard will not respond,
but connecting a PS/2 keyboard will work fine.
